The City of Takoma Park established the City as a Nuclear-Free zone with the passage of the Takoma Park Nuclear Free Act in 1983. The Act prohibits work on nuclear weapons, including transportation and storage of such weapons within the City, and prohibits the City from doing business with companies that produce nuclear weapons or their components, ...
